Heeslingen is a charming town located in Lower Saxony, Germany. If you are planning a visit to this picturesque destination, there are several transportation options available to reach Heeslingen.
If you are traveling from abroad, the nearest international airports to Heeslingen are Hamburg Airport and Bremen Airport. From there, you can easily reach Heeslingen by renting a car or taking a train.
Heeslingen has its own train station, making it easily accessible by rail. You can take a train from major cities such as Hamburg or Bremen to reach Heeslingen. The train journey offers scenic views of the German countryside and is a comfortable way to travel.
If you prefer to drive, Heeslingen is conveniently located near major highways. From Hamburg, you can take the A1 and A27 highways, and from Bremen, the A1 and A1 highways. The drive to Heeslingen is approximately an hour from both cities, depending on traffic conditions.
Another option to reach Heeslingen is by bus. There are several bus services available from nearby towns and cities. You can check the schedules and book your tickets in advance for a hassle-free journey.
If you are an adventure enthusiast or prefer eco-friendly transportation, cycling to Heeslingen is a great option. The region offers well-maintained cycling paths, allowing you to enjoy the scenic beauty of the surroundings while reaching your destination.

Heeslingen is a small municipality located in Lower Saxony, Germany. Situated in the district of Rotenburg, Heeslingen is known for its picturesque landscapes and charming rural atmosphere. The town is surrounded by lush green fields, rolling hills, and dense forests, making it an ideal destination for nature lovers and outdoor enthusiasts.
Heeslingen is steeped in history, with its origins dating back to the Middle Ages. The town's architecture reflects its rich heritage, with traditional half-timbered houses dotting the streets. The historic St. John's Church, a prominent landmark in Heeslingen, showcases Gothic architecture and stands as a testament to the town's medieval past.
In addition to its historical significance, Heeslingen offers a range of recreational activities for visitors. The nearby nature reserves provide ample opportunities for hiking, cycling, and birdwatching. The idyllic countryside is perfect for leisurely strolls and picnics, allowing visitors to immerse themselves in the tranquility of nature.
Heeslingen also hosts various cultural events throughout the year, including traditional festivals, music concerts, and art exhibitions. These events provide a glimpse into the local culture and offer a chance to connect with the community. The town's warm and welcoming atmosphere, coupled with its natural beauty, makes Heeslingen an inviting destination for both locals and tourists alike.
